Youth Artist Project: Winnie the Pooh KIDS
APPLY TODAY!
Back for the sixth year, the Youth Artist Project partners student artists with professional theatre artists and educators to bring a show to life! The student team will design and direct Disney’s Winnie the Pooh KIDS under the mentorship of the professional team, and each student production team member will receive a stipend of $250 at the end of the process.
